[quote=Anonymous]We were in a situation where we moved into a family home that one sibling wanted to sell while another did not. We paid rent to the one who wanted to sell which pacified her until the siblings could agree on what to do. You don’t mention if your brother expects to have to move out. That’s a huge part of this puzzle. So is the relationship between the siblings. I know my brother would totally understand and respond to urgency if I needed my share of money for immediate needs (my child heading to college next year) vs. my insisting on my share immediately when I only wanted to put it away for retirement which is not a rush. Forcing him to rush into something would only create friction in that case. That said, it sounds like your brother has time to plan - provided you open this conversation now rather than waiting for your father to pass.[/quote]
